A child must complete 3 years of age by March 31st of the admission year to be eligible for Nursery admission. Please carry the original birth certificate at the time of application.
For Nursery to Class II, there is a simple interaction session with the child and parents. For Class III and above, students undergo a basic written assessment in core subjects along with an interview.
You will need the birth certificate, transfer certificate (for Class II onward), previous report card, Aadhar card copies of the student and parents, address proof, and passport-size photographs. A full checklist is available on our How to Apply page.
Yes, LRPS provides bus transport covering major routes within Leh and nearby villages. Transport fee varies by distance, please contact the school office for route details and charges.
Yes, hostel/boarding facilities are available for students. Please contact the school administration for details regarding accommodation, eligibility, and hostel admission procedures.
English is the primary medium of instruction across all classes, in line with our CBSE affiliation. Hindi and local language (Bodhi/Ladakhi) are also taught as subjects.
Yes. Merit-based and need-based scholarships are available, including for incoming students with an excellent academic record from their previous school. Visit our Scholarships page for full details.
Mid-session admissions are considered on a case-by-case basis, subject to seat availability in the relevant class. Please contact the admissions office directly to check current availability.
LRPS has a prescribed uniform for daily wear and a separate uniform for physical education / sports days. Uniforms can be stitched/purchased from designated vendors recommended by the school, details are shared after admission confirmation.
We communicate through the school notice board, circulars sent home with students, the school website's News section, and periodic Parent-Teacher Meetings (PTMs).
